Aircraft Maintenance

MAG’s Part 145 Certified Repair Station provides fixed-wing aircraft maintenance for most any make and model of piston or turbine aircraft. MAG maintains aircraft employing some of the most experienced technicians in the industry and maintains an exceptional safety record.
